Sovereign procurement reviews are won on numbers, not ideals. Every MOD/Gov buyer asks: "What will this cost me for 30 days, and what is that cost relative to the US-cloud alternative?"
This page answers that question conservatively. Every line is open: vendors, assumptions, hardware and exit credits are listed and reproducible.
| Tier | Operators | Deployment | Use case |
|---|---|---|---|
| T1 | 1 | Single MacBook SC-cleared | Solo operator with executive function |
| T2 | 3 | Departmental BFT enclave | Regional unit / NHS trust / council |
| T3 | 10 | MOD ONI-class pilot | Forward-deployable command unit |

L11 — Exit credit — the only line that often surprises reviewers — is the appreciated transfer of the deployed artefacts to the next deployment or to the buyer's own permanent operation.
DEFONEOS is happy to not win the next deployment. The artefacts travel with the buyer.
| Risk | Likelihood | Cost impact | Mitigation |
|---|---|---|---|
| Hardware delivery delay (UK supplier) | Medium | +5 to +10 days onboarding | Stock from 2 UK suppliers pre-pilot |
| SC clearance applied late | High (depends on buyer) | Pilot delayed until cleared | Engage SC clearance in parallel to BOM |
| Cyber Essentials assessment backlog | Low | +1 to +2 weeks attestation | Apply during hardware-lead-time window |
| BFT witness availability | Low | Sign-off delayed 1 day | 24-watch standby for in-window quorum |
| US-cloud vendor price reduction | Medium | −10% to −25% saving | Annual rebid — long-run saving grows |
